Output 1763142c3bc4c70a8ed9cb6281300b7a506be1c69b6d18a500a2124da60b7203:17

value
2850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f6e2b54a670790037c72fbe0fb8f2009555cee OP_EQUAL
address
3Dp4smy6BfacGQzBRCMMxQwtodAgXBU8M9
transaction
1763142c3bc4c70a8ed9cb6281300b7a506be1c69b6d18a500a2124da60b7203
spent
true